Report reveals Olympus smart contract was hacked, lost $300,000, investor relief team

reportAn attacker hacked the Olympus Smart Contract DAO organization, the platform lost 30,437 OHM Tokens, or $300,000 worth of funds, caused by the platform’s inability to verify the hacker’s withdrawal requests.

The Olympus team realized that the platform was hacked and it came out.announce“This morning an unsuspecting person attacked the platform. The hacker was able to withdraw approximately 30,000 OHM (approximately $300,000 worth of coins).

The team said the funds staked on the platform were unaffected and remain secure, and Olympus said it would treat users affected by the hack. too

Olympus DAO is a DeFi platform with OHM token reserves. It offers crypto-currency bonds held in OHM tokens. The DAO offers OHM tokens at a discount to cryptocurrency traders.

This is the process of maintaining DAO reserves, and Olympus services use smart contracts to offer cryptocurrency bonds to investors. One of these smart contracts is the target of hackers.
